San Diego Padres vs New York Mets
August 22, 1997 Box Score

The box score below is an accurate record of events for the baseball contest played on August 22, 1997 at Shea Stadium. The New York Mets defeated the San Diego Padres and the box score is "ready to surrender its truth to the knowing eye."

San Diego Padres 8, New York Mets 9

San Diego Padres ab   r   h rbi
Veras Q. 2b 5 2 3 2
Finley cf 5 1 3 0
Gwynn rf 4 0 1 2
  Jones rf 1 0 0 0
Caminiti 3b 4 1 1 0
Sweeney 1b 3 1 1 1
  Cianfrocco ph,1b 2 1 1 0
Vaughn lf 4 0 0 0
Gomez ss 5 1 0 0
Flaherty c 6 1 2 2
Hamilton p 3 0 0 1
  Veras D. p 0 0 0 0
  Worrell p 0 0 0 0
  Shipley ph 0 0 0 0
  Hoffman p 0 0 0 0
  Rivera ph 1 0 0 0
  Bochtler p 0 0 0 0
  Cunnane p 0 0 0 0
Totals 43 8 12 8
New York Mets ab   r   h rbi
Everett lf,cf 5 1 1 0
Franco M. 3b 4 1 2 2
  Perez p 0 0 0 0
  Gilkey lf 2 0 0 0
Olerud 1b 5 1 1 1
Hundley c 4 1 3 3
Baerga 2b 5 1 2 1
McRae cf 2 0 0 0
  Lidle p 0 0 0 0
  Lopez ph 1 1 1 0
  Alfonzo 3b 2 0 0 0
Ochoa rf 4 0 0 0
  Rojas p 0 0 0 0
  Bohanon ph 1 0 0 0
  Franco J. p 0 0 0 0
Ordonez ss 5 1 1 1
Harnisch p 1 0 0 0
  Huskey lf,rf 4 2 2 1
Totals 45 9 13 9
San Diego 210 020 003 008122
New York 100 000 403 019130
  San Diego Padres IP H R ER BB SO
Hamilton   6.1 8 5 5 1 3
  Veras   0.2 1 0 0 1 0
  Worrell   1.0 1 0 0 0 0
  Hoffman   2.0 3 3 3 0 2
  Bochtler  L (3-6) 0.2 0 1 0 2 0
  Cunnane   0.0 0 0 0 1 0
Totals
10.2
13
9
8
5
5
  New York Mets IP H R ER BB SO
Harnisch   4.0 7 5 5 3 4
  Lidle   3.0 2 0 0 2 1
  Perez   1.2 1 2 2 1 1
  Rojas   1.1 2 1 1 2 3
  Franco  W (4-1) 1.0 0 0 0 0 2
Totals
11.0
12
8
8
8
11

  E–Sweeney (1), Cianfrocco (6).  DP–San Diego 1.  2B–San Diego Finley (19,off Harnisch); Q Veras (21,off Rojas), New York M Franco (5,off D Veras); Everett (24,off Hoffman); Olerud (29,off Hoffman).  HR–New York Hundley (27,9th inning off Hoffman 1 on, 2 out).  SF–Gwynn (11,off Harnisch); Hamilton (1,off Lidle).  HBP–Q Veras (6,by Harnisch).  IBB–Hundley (15,by Bochtler).  SB–Caminiti (9,2nd base off Rojas/Hundley).  HBP–Harnisch (1,Q Veras).  IBB–Bochtler (4,Hundley).  U-HP–Brian Gibbons, 1B–Frank Pulli, 2B–Bob Davidson, 3B–Brian Gorman.  T–4:10.  A–20,229.
